POSITION SUMMARY:
This role serves as a trusted advisor to the People Resources leadership, organization leaders, and employees, fostering a positive workplace culture and ensuring alignment with best practices and legal requirements.
The Director of People Resources is a transformational leader responsible for designing and executing scalable HR processes that enhance the employee experience. This role is focused on process improvement, optimizing operational efficiency, and implementing best practices to support organizational growth. As a strategic partner, the Human Resources Director will collaborate with cross-department and functional leaders to deliver impactful people solutions.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Lead the Field HR team (People Relations and People Support) departments, focusing on scalable processes that enhance employee engagement.
- Champion a seamless employee experience by overseeing the entire employee lifecycle, from welcoming new hires to thoughtful offboarding, while ensuring data integrity, compliance and a high level of support throughout each stage.
- Build and lead a best-in-class Field HR team by leveraging innovative HR technology and systems to optimize processes while driving customer services through high-touch, approachability and accessibility to employees at all levels.
- Lead the development and maintenance of a scalable job architecture that not only ensures consistency and compliance but also drives employee engagement through transparent career progression and clear growth opportunities.
- Collaborates with Territory Business Leadership to develop and implement change management and organizational design initiatives.
- Provide expertise in planning and executing large-scale organizational changes and interventions.
- Foster a culture of continuous improvement by aligning change strategies with business objectives.
- Oversee the management and optimization of the HRIS (Nitro), identifying opportunities to enhance system functionality, streamline HR processes, and improve employee experience.
- Develop and track key performance indicators (KPIs) and metrics that measure the effectiveness of HR programs, ensuring alignment with the company's breakthrough objectives to drive data-informed decision-making.
- Collaborates with internal Employment Law department and facilitate compliance with employment laws and regulations, including policy updates and training programs.
- Manage compliance reporting and ensure adherence to legal standards related to workforce management.
- Serve as a subject matter expert on compliance issues and risk mitigation.

REQUIRED SKILLS & EXPERTISE:
- 7+ years of progressive Business & HR related experience with demonstrated ability to lead the development and execution of an organizational agenda
- Deep understanding of HR best practices, policies, and compliance regulations.
- Familiarity with employment laws and regulations (local, state, and federal).
- Proven history with HRIS platform scalability and other HR technology solutions.
- Ability to leverage data analytics and reporting tools to inform strategic decisions.
- Proven ability to build, mentor, and lead a high-performing HR field team.
- Strong project management skills to drive initiatives and process improvements.
- Experience fostering a high-touch, employee-centered HR service culture.
- Skills in developing and monitoring KPIs to measure the effectiveness of HR programs.
- Competence in creating dashboards and reports to track operational performance.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to present complex information clearly.
- Ability to develop scalable HR processes that adapt to organizational growth.
- Strong business acumen and how HR strategies can support organizational goals.
- Ability to align HR practices with company objectives, fostering a results-oriented culture.
- Skills in balancing strategic planning with day-to-day operational management.
EDUCATION & EXPERIENCE:
- Bachelor's degree or equivalent experience required.
- PHR, SHRM-CP, SHRM-SCP highly preferred.
